From Humble Beginnings to TV Stardom
Before we dive into the numbers, let's take a quick peek into Rachael Ray's journey. Born on August 25, 1968, in Glens Falls, New York, Rachael didn't always have a silver spoon in her mouth. Her parents owned a restaurant, so she grew up in the bustling kitchen environment. She started working there at the age of 6, and by 16, she was a chef at a local pizza joint.
Rachael's big break came in 2001 when she was discovered by Food Network executives at a food and wine festival. They were impressed by her energetic personality and knack for creating delicious, yet simple, dishes. This led to her own show, 30 Minute Meals, which premiered in 2001 and quickly became a hit.

The Rachael Ray Empire: TV Shows, Cookbooks, and More
So, where did all that money come from? Let's break it down.
TV Shows
Rachael Ray's TV career is the backbone of her wealth. Her shows, such as 30 Minute Meals, Rachael Ray's Tasty Travels, and Rachael Ray, have been on air for years, generating consistent income.
Cookbooks
Rachael Ray is a New York Times bestselling author, with over 20 cookbooks under her belt. Her books, like 30 Minute Meals and Express Lane Meals, have sold millions of copies worldwide.
Magazine and Syndicated Column
In 2005, Rachael Ray launched her own magazine, Every Day with Rachael Ray. She also has a syndicated column, Rachael Ray's Table, which appears in newspapers across the country.
Business Ventures
Rachael Ray has her own line of cookware, pet food, and food products. She also has a restaurant, Rachael Ray's Pizano Pasta & Vino Cucina, in New York City.
